Output 866d2d130a147ece2776e128a4c0a24f40c5db7027e44441ec1aa31afc16a07d:1

value
12018769
script pubkey
OP_0 OP_PUSHBYTES_20 d04b3c5681e91e4408e3ab0be31186aee922d0cc
address
ltc1q6p9nc45pay0ygz8r4v97xyvx4m5j95xvfcepy8
transaction
866d2d130a147ece2776e128a4c0a24f40c5db7027e44441ec1aa31afc16a07d
spent
true